I have an H&R 12 gauge single shot that I believe is a 1908 model (breaks into 3 pieces with the snap on foregrip) but it is marked differently than any I have seen online or off. It only has writing on the left side and it is only two lines. First line is "HARRINGTON & RICHARDSON ARMS CO,." Second line is "WORCESTER MASS, U.S.A. PAT FEB.27.00." There is also the serial number behind the trigger guard which is "35288". The barrel is 30" long with a steel bead sight and marked "12 GA CHOKE". It can be difficult to identify Harrington & Richardson Model 1900, Model 1905 and Model 1908s. H & R had a habit of changing model designations and rarely marked the model number on the gun. And add to this fact, they often changed model designations back and forth,some years the Model 1908 was called the Model 1908 while at other times it was called the No. 6, No. 7, NO. 8 or No.9 seemingly without rhyme or reason. My reference book,"The Breech Loading Shotgun In America. 1860 To 1940" shows that the patent dates were marked as follows: On the Model 1900-Pat.20/27 1900, the Model 1905 was marked Pat. 20/27 1900 (and) 14 May 1901 while the Model 1908 had no patent date stamped on it. Assuming your gun is a Model 1900, it was made in 1903.

I failed to do what they taught us in the military and that was "Read the full (and that was not the word they used) question." There are illustrations and verbal descriptions of each gun in the reference and here's each.

H & R Model1900 Single Gun. " Thais gun can be most easily identified by the method of take down.. namely a spring loaded lever must be lifted clear of the frame and turned 1/4 turn and pulled out to free the barrel. In addition the forend must be unscrewed to be removed from the barrel.

Mode,1905 Single Gun. Mostly identified by its small bore size (24 gauge, 28 gauge, .44 caliber, .45 caliber, 12 MM, 14 MM and .410 Eley as well as .45-70 Government Shot Cartridge, discontinued in 1915). other than this, gun had the same takedown method as the Model 1900.

Model 1908 (two models, one Standard Frame and the other Heavy Breech Frame) This gun takes down in the same manner as the Models 1900 and 1905 except the forend is a snap type and not a screw type.

And yes, that was my bad, all markings on these old guns were in upper case and one should not make abbreviations, deletions or changes. i.e. COMPANY for CO. or the reverse. It is difficult to see in the illustrations in the reference (the guns are shown from the left side but the Model 1908 Heavy Breech does not appear to have a removeable hinge pin.

Just because the chamber's the same length as modern shotshells doesn't mean it's safe.

In 1925, the ammo companies changed all shotshell ammo, and started loading with a different powder to higher pressures than previously - coincidentally causing several "name" shotgun companies (Ithaca, for one) to revise their product line(s).

IF it checks out as being "on face" and has no bbl defects like dents, bulges, rust or cracks, then proper, low-powered ammo is available from the likes of RST and PolyWad.

The first smokeless powder for shotgun shells was Wood powder introduced in 1876. Shotgunners being a hidebound lot were rather slow to embrace smokeless powder, but by the 1890s it was coming on strong. In 1890, Captain A.W. Money came to America from England, and established the American E.C. and Schultze Powder Company in Oakland Park, Bergen County, New Jersey, with offices on Broadway in New York City, to manufacture smokeless shotgun powders. In 1893, Union Metallic Cartridge Co. was already offering smokeless powder shotshells, and that year Winchester was providing them to selected shooters with Winchester offering them to the general public in 1894. The American ammunition companies held their smokeless powder loads offered in the 2 5/8 inch 12-gauge shells lower than those offered in the 2 3/4 inch and longer shells. The very heaviest 2 5/8 inch shells I find offered were 3 1/4 drams of bulk smokeless powder or 26 grains of dense smokeless powders such as Ballistite or Infallible with 1 1/4 ounces of shot. In 2 3/4 inch and longer shells they offered 3 1/2 drams of bulk smokeless powders or 28 grains of Ballistite or Infallible dense smokeless powders with the same 1 1/4 ounce of shot. These loads were very high pressure according to a DuPont Smokeless Shotgun Powders (1933) book I have. It shows the 3 1/2 drams of DuPont bulk smokeless powder pushing 1 1/4 ounces of shot as being 11,700 pounds; 3 1/2 drams of Schultze bulk smokeless powders pushing 1 1/4 ounces of shot being 11,800 pounds and the 28-grains of Ballistite pushing the 1 1/4 ounces of shot being 12,600 pounds!!! There were plenty of lighter loads being offered, but American shotgunners being what they are, I'm sure many were opting for the heaviest loads available. The same situation held with the 16- and 20-gauge shells. The "standard" 2 1/2 inch 20-gauge shells and the "standard" 2 9/16 inch 16-gauge shells carried slightly milder loads than the extra cost longer shells in 2 3/4, 2 7/8, and 3-inch lengths.

Many folks believe that the "modern" shotshells loaded with progressive burning smokeless powders, introduced in the early 1920s, Western Cartridge Company's Super-X loads leading the way, were higher pressure than the old bulk and dense smokeless powder loads. Reading period literature, this is not the case. With progressive burning smokeless powders they were able to move out equal shot loads at higher velocity or a heavier shot load at equal velocity, but at lower pressure than the old style bulk or dense smokeless powders.

I've picked up a little 96-page Du Pont Smokeless Shotgun Powders booklet written by Wallace H. Coxe, Ballistic Engineer, Brandywine Laboratory, Smokeless Powder Department, copyright 1928. It is primarily about Du Pont Oval progressive burning smokeless powder, but does a lot of comparisons with earlier style bulk and dense smokeless. As a Du Pont Oval example, he states on page 25 -

"Du Pont Oval can be loaded with 1 3/8 ounces of shot in a 12-gauge shotgun to develop the same velocity and pressure as obtained with a load of 3 1/2 drams of Du Pont Bulk Smokeless Powder or 28 grains of Ballistite and 1 1/4 ounces of shot. The relation naturally holds with other charges, but as Du Pont Oval is used principally for maximum loads the comparison is more striking as it shows the possibility of using a heavy load with Du Pont Oval that would be an abnormal load were it used with Du Pont Bulk Smokeless, Ballistite, or other existing old-style types of shotgun powders. As the pressures developed by this load of 1 3/8 ounces of shot with Du Pont Oval are the same as the pressures developed by 1 1/4 ounces of shot with 3 1/2 drams of Du Pont Bulk Smokeless, or 28 grains of Ballistite, it is impracticable to increase further the weight of shot charge with DuPont Oval. It is not advisable to load ammunition to the limit of safety of a shotgun for the reason that the pressures at this high level will ruin the pattern percentage developed by the load."

IMHO those Damascus barrel warnings that began appearing on shotshell boxes by the early 1930s were more a thinly veiled attempt to coerce shooters into buying new guns, though they probably did have some relavence to all those cheap Belgian imports that came into North America from 1880 to WW-I. All the major U.S. manufacturers guaranteed their Twist and Damascus barrel guns for nitro powders. Most U.S. manufacturers dropped their composite iron and steel barrels when the sources of the rough tubes dried up with the outbreak of WW-I, but at least Parker Bros. continued to offer them into the late 1920s. There is at least one late Parker Bros. double with Bernard barrels, vent rib, beavertail forearm and single selective trigger known.

All the above being said, I don't mean to imply that any given gun is safe to shoot. No one can tell you over the internet that a gun is safe to shoot and with what ammunition. Only a competent gunsmith (not as many out there as you might like to think) with the gun in hand, can make that assessment!!
